Package com.yahoo.config.subscription
Class ConfigInstanceSerializer
java.lang.Object
com.yahoo.config.subscription.ConfigInstanceSerializer
- All Implemented Interfaces:
com.yahoo.config.Serializer
Implements a config instance serializer, serializing a config instance to a slime object.
- Author:
- Ulf Lilleengen
-
Constructor Summary
ConstructorDescriptionConfigInstanceSerializer
(com.yahoo.slime.Slime slime) ConfigInstanceSerializer
(com.yahoo.slime.Slime slime, com.yahoo.slime.Cursor root) -
Method Summary
Modifier and TypeMethodDescriptioncom.yahoo.config.Serializer
createArray
(String name) com.yahoo.config.Serializer
com.yahoo.config.Serializer
createInner
(String name) com.yahoo.config.Serializer
void
serialize
(boolean value) void
serialize
(double value) void
serialize
(int value) void
serialize
(long value) void
void
void
void
void
void
-
Constructor Details
-
ConfigInstanceSerializer
public ConfigInstanceSerializer(com.yahoo.slime.Slime slime) -
ConfigInstanceSerializer
public ConfigInstanceSerializer(com.yahoo.slime.Slime slime, com.yahoo.slime.Cursor root)
-
-
Method Details
-
createInner
- Specified by:
createInner
in interfacecom.yahoo.config.Serializer
-
createArray
- Specified by:
createArray
in interfacecom.yahoo.config.Serializer
-
createInner
public com.yahoo.config.Serializer createInner()- Specified by:
createInner
in interfacecom.yahoo.config.Serializer
-
createMap
- Specified by:
createMap
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
public void serialize(boolean value) -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
public void serialize(double value) -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
public void serialize(long value) -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
public void serialize(int value) -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-
serialize
- Specified by:
serialize
in interfacecom.yahoo.config.Serializer
-